The NBA has the cart (the draft) before the horse (free agency).  It needs to be the other way around.  The NFL has restructured its off season by pushing the draft into May to allow more free agent time.  That allows teams to sign free agents to fill holes prior to the draft.

 

The NBA is suffering from its own shortsightedness.  The value of the draft has been drastically reduced by the one and done rule imposed by the league.  Prior to that rule only a handful of players came into the league directly from high school.  Many of the remaining players stayed in college for two or three years.  In that time they became much more prepared to play in the NBA.
